24 years agoThe 2.0b2 change to write .pyc files in exclusive mode (if possible)
Tim Peters [Fri, 29 Sep 2000 04:03:10 +0000 (04:03 +0000)]
The 2.0b2 change to write .pyc files in exclusive mode (if possible)
unintentionally caused them to get written in text mode under Windows.
As a result, when .pyc files were later read-- in binary mode --the
magic number was always wrong (note that .pyc magic numbers deliberately
include \r and \n characters, so this was "good" breakage, 100% across
all .pyc files, not random corruption in a subset).  Fixed that.

24 years agopopen4(), class Popen4: popen4() support for Unix.
Fred Drake [Thu, 28 Sep 2000 19:07:53 +0000 (19:07 +0000)]
popen4(), class Popen4:  popen4() support for Unix.

popen2(), popen3():  Reversed order of bufsize and mode parameters to
                     comply with what was here before (Python 1.5.2).

class Popen3:  Factored the __init__() into a more basic initializer and
               a helper method, to allow some re-use by the Popen4 class.
               Use os.dup2() instead of os.dup() to create the proper
               file descriptors in the child process.

This closes SourceForge bug #115330 and partially closes #115353.

24 years agoAllow spaces in section names.
Fred Drake [Wed, 27 Sep 2000 22:43:54 +0000 (22:43 +0000)]
Allow spaces in section names.
Do not expose the __name__ when reporting the list of options available
for a section since that is for internal use.

This closes SourceForge bug #115357.

Additionally, define InterpolationDepthError and MAX_INTERPOLATION_DEPTH.
The exception is raised by get*() when value interpolation cannot be
completed within the defined recursion limit.  The constant is only
informative; changing it will not affect the allowed depth.

Fix the exit from get() so that None is not returned if the depth is met
or exceeded; either return the value of raise InterpolationDepthError.

24 years agoBig patch from Rene Liebscher to simplify the CCompiler API and
Greg Ward [Wed, 27 Sep 2000 02:08:14 +0000 (02:08 +0000)]
Big patch from Rene Liebscher to simplify the CCompiler API and
implementations.  Details:
  * replace 'link_shared_object()', 'link_shared_lib()', and
    'link_executable()' with 'link()', which is (roughly)
    the union of the three methods it replaces
  * in all implementation classes (UnixCCompiler, MSVCCompiler, etc.),
    ditch the old 'link_*()' methods and replace them with 'link()'
  * in the abstract base class (CCompiler), add the old 'link_*()'
    methods as wrappers around the new 'link()' (they also print
    a warning of the deprecated interface)

Also increases consistency between MSVCCompiler and BCPPCompiler,
hopefully to make it easier to factor out the mythical WindowsCCompiler
class.  Details:
  * use 'self.linker' instead of 'self.link'
  * add ability to compile resource files to BCPPCompiler
  * added (redundant?) 'object_filename()' method to BCPPCompiler
  * only generate a .def file if 'export_symbols' defined
